Output 339422b91308e3bd8d14b4d4574430d7d42ba9910d94f3b77bbc8ea4cb3fbb53:70

value
18786
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2353128cb7754581da6ee8d988bbb891fdf974fa815d92e83d8acd29447a4a64
address
bc1pydf39r9hw4zcrknwarvc3wacj87lja86s9we96pa3txjj3r6ffjqzrsws8
transaction
339422b91308e3bd8d14b4d4574430d7d42ba9910d94f3b77bbc8ea4cb3fbb53
spent
true